Cast"er (?), n. 1.
One who casts; as, caster of stones, etc. ; a
caster of cannon; a caster of accounts.
2. A vial, cruet, or other small vessel,
used to contain condiments at the table; as, a set of
casters.
3. A stand to hold a set of
cruets.
4. A small wheel on a swivel, on which
furniture is supported and moved.
- Webster's Unabridged Dictionary (1913)

- A wheeled assembly attached to a larger object at its base to facilitate rolling. A caster usually consists of
- a wheel, which may be plastic, a hard elastomer, or metal
- an axle
- a mounting provision, usually a stem, flange, or plate
- (sometimes) a swivel which allows the caster to rotate for steering
Many office chairs roll on a set of casters.
